I just found my old Virago for sale! Well, actually it JUST sold, but still, that's pretty cool! I bought this '96 Virago 1100 brand new in '98 at Ab's Motorcycles in Oshawa. I was just 16yrs old. I rode it until 2010, when I gave it to my Wife and bought my '01 Bandit. She rode it until 2012 when she had a small accident on it and broke her shoulder. She became pregnant that same year and decided to quit riding. There was almost no damage to the bike (the Wife took the brunt of it). That same year my Dad was looking to get back into riding after almost a decade away from it. He bought it, swapped out the original seat for the Mustang seat, installed the passing lamps too. He had the bike until 2015 when he traded it on a 2012 Yamaha Roadstar at Ben's Motorcycles. Ben's put it in their auction and I figured I'd never see it again! Then today, I'm killing time looking at bikes for sale, and there it is at Cycle World in Toronto! When I last saw it it had a HUGE National Cycles windscreen on it (my Dad's doing), Yamaha engine guards and saddle bags with a big scuff on them (from my Wife's crash).
Glad to see the old girl has found her way into some new hands and will be rolling down the street again! I have so many great memories of that bike. It was my second bike, but I only had my first bike less than a year. I did everything and went everywhere on this bike. It served me really well with almost no repairs needed.
